Hey everybody I have a garmin echo 150 well my first question is how far down do I have to put the tranducer in the water? I had mines strapped to my rod holders which sits right above the water should I try and bring it down a lil more or is it fine there ... My second question is I'm having trouble adjusting the ff to get a clear pic i see the bottom clearly but the top and middle has a bunch of stuff in it that could possibly be trash?

Most likely it's schools of bait fish. I have the echo 100, if it's too cloudy looking check your gain setting. I have mine set around 70% and it's cloudy but it gives good bottom detail
More gain you have the darker/cloudier the screen you will have.

For the transducer, you want the whole punk to be jn the water at all times.
